应用系统的后台代码已经成为影响用户体验和系统性能的关键因素。后台代码的优化不仅能够提升应用性能,还能为用户提供更加流畅、高效的体验。本文将从后台代码优化的重要性、策略和方法等方面进行探讨,以期为我国应用开发提供有益的借鉴。
一、后台代码优化的重要性
1. 提升应用性能
后台代码的优化能够降低系统资源的消耗,提高数据处理速度,从而提升应用性能。在用户体验方面,快速响应、流畅操作等都是优化后台代码带来的直接效益。
2. 提高用户体验
优化后台代码能够减少系统错误,提高应用的稳定性。通过优化算法和数据处理方式,可以降低用户在使用过程中的等待时间,提升用户体验。
3. 降低开发成本
后台代码优化可以减少系统资源消耗,降低服务器成本。优化后的代码易于维护和扩展,有助于降低后期开发成本。
二、后台代码优化策略
1. 数据库优化
(1)合理设计数据库表结构,避免数据冗余和重复。
(2)采用合适的索引策略,提高数据查询速度。
(3)优化SQL语句,减少数据库访问次数。
2. 算法优化
(1)选择高效的算法,降低时间复杂度和空间复杂度。
(2)优化循环结构,减少不必要的计算。
(3)合理使用缓存技术,减少重复计算。
3. 代码结构优化
(1)模块化设计,提高代码可读性和可维护性。
(2)合理使用设计模式,提高代码复用性。
(3)避免代码冗余,减少重复代码。
4. 资源管理优化
(1)合理分配内存,减少内存泄漏。
(2)优化网络请求,降低网络延迟。
(3)使用线程池,提高并发处理能力。
三、案例分析
以某电商网站为例,通过优化后台代码,实现了以下效果:
1. 数据库优化:通过合理设计数据库表结构,采用合适的索引策略,优化SQL语句,使商品查询速度提升了50%。
2. 算法优化:优化推荐算法,提高推荐准确率,增加用户粘性。
3. 代码结构优化:采用模块化设计,提高代码可读性和可维护性,降低开发成本。
4. 资源管理优化:优化内存和线程池管理,降低系统资源消耗,提高并发处理能力。
后台代码优化对于提升应用性能和用户体验具有重要意义。通过合理运用优化策略,可以有效降低系统资源消耗,提高数据处理速度,从而为用户提供更加流畅、高效的体验。在我国应用开发过程中,应高度重视后台代码优化,以提高我国应用软件的整体竞争力。